Transaction 1149f5cae2b2d933c5e72615c179c69a3e81aea74b9890a3aef5eaa62f8bf022

2 Input
1 Outputs
  • 1149f5cae2b2d933c5e72615c179c69a3e81aea74b9890a3aef5eaa62f8bf022:0
  • value  273851927
    address  34REW2yQ1Q786qXQeXAH5kdHdmBZ57Gyu5